Business Analyst/ Scrum Master (Remote Opportuinty)

100% Remote Full-time Open now

VetsEZ is seeking a Business Analyst/ Scrum Master to be a part of a remote team supporting the Department of Veterans Affairs. The ideal candidate will lead and facilitate Agile practices to ensure efficient team collaboration and smooth project delivery. They should have a strong background in engaging with business stakeholders, gathering and analyzing business requirements, and driving process improvements to help the team achieve its goals effectively. Responsibilities:

  • Lead end-to-end requirement gathering activities, including defining scope, setting goals, managing deliverables, and ensuring alignment with client and organizational objectives.
  • Facilitate Scrum ceremonies (Daily Stand-ups, PI Planning, Retrospectives, Demos) and proactively identify and remove impediments to ensure team progress.
  • Analyze complex business problems, gather user requirements, and recommend IT solutions by collaborating closely with stakeholders, managers, and end users.
  • Apply knowledge of Behavior-Driven and Test-Driven Development (BDD/TDD) to support high-quality software delivery practices.
  • Work cross-functionally with developers and UX/UI designers to translate business needs into user-centric, functional digital experiences.
  • Promote Agile best practices, coach team members, and provide recommendations to project stakeholders on process improvement and standardization.
  • Monitor team performance using Agile metrics such as velocity and burndown charts and provide regular progress reports.
  • Manage team communication, update documentation, and conduct post-project evaluations to capture lessons learned and support continuous improvement.
  • Support procurement planning, advise on technical resources and tooling, and remain flexible in adapting to evolving team or project needs.

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, Engineering, or an equivalent discipline.
  • 8+ years of experience as a Business Analyst and/or Scrum Master leading Agile teams on large-scale software, data-management, and integration projects.
  • Proficient in Agile frameworks including SAFe and Kanban, with hands-on experience using tools such as Jira, ServiceNow, and Trello for backlog and sprint management.
  • Strong analytical skills with demonstrated expertise in conducting research, eliciting requirements, and translating business needs into well-defined user stories and functional specifications.
  • Experience in designing wireframes, explaining layout and functionality to clients, and incorporating feedback into iterative prototypes.
  • Expertise in leveraging Microsoft Office 365 tools (Project, Visio, PowerPoint, Excel, Word) and Atlassian/ServiceNow environments.
  • Excellent communication abilities, including drafting clear documentation and delivering focused briefings to senior leadership, with attention to capturing decisions and follow-ups.
  • Experience in onboarding and mentoring new users/ team members on Agile processes, tools, and best practices.
  • Proven ability to coordinate cross-functional teams, manage expectations, and present complex information to technical and non-technical audiences.

Additional Qualifications:

  • SAFe Practitioner, SAFe Certified Scrum Master or similar certifications.
  • Experience with Scaled Agile Framework (SAFe) or other Agile frameworks.
